The date was April 17, 1964. Intermediate sized muscle cars, with big block engines were gradually replacing the fullsized muscle car. Lee Iacocca, Ford's General Manager, had always invisioned a small sports car to be the next hot item in the street wars.
Therefore the Ford Mustang was introduced as a 1965 model that was based on the compact Falcon. It came with an obligatory back seat and a multitude of options that would give the buyer an opportunity to customize their purchase, and echo in the era of the mustang.
